Environmental Pollution and Climatic Change,

Abstract

The paper discusses environmental pollution and climatic change. Discussions begin on atmospheric pollution on a global scale, followed by anthropogenic modification of global climage, numerical experiment of climatic change, cooling in the northern hemisphere, environmental influence on the Japan climate, climatic variation related to the mass balance of prennial snow patches, and secular variation of air temperature and humidity in some suburan localities. Finally, the generalities of artificial climate control are presented. (Author)
